I replaced the cycling thermostat.  The burner stays on for 25 sec then off for 45 sec.  I observed thru the peephole.  I took apart the exhaust covering and it was clean as well as the blower wheel.  The burner does stay on longer when the exhaust vent tube is off.  The exhaust vent is approx. 20ft and flexible plastic.  Is it the exhaust vent?  Do I need the thermal cut off kit?  The burner turns on no problem so I think the coils are fine.  Any help appreciated.

The burner turns on no problem so I think the coils are fine

Coils tend to fail after heating up so they could be the problem. 
 

But if it heats well with vent disconnected it’s likely your vent Is clogged.

The exhaust vent is approx. 20ft and flexible plastic

This is a big part of your problem - the plastic vent is not up to code, (plastic vent tube is only for bathroom vents never for dryers anymore).

OK to use the foil flex vent designed for dryers but should never really have more 8 ft max of flexible foil vent - it is only designed to be used from the dryer to the wall pipe.

You should replaced all but 3 or 4 feet of the plastic vent tube with 4" metal pipe and only use a 3 to 4 ft section of flexible foil vent behind dryer to metal piping.
